:hammer:Turned a freak edge rusher into a 5 Tech...sucking up blocks. That's dumb. No wonder a bunch of kids bailed to Ole Miss.
 
Stewart needs a bit of work on his hand fighting and knowing what counters to use and when to use them. Relies too much on his athletic ability since it came easy for him. But his play against the run is elite and probably is the best run defender of any DL in the draft. He just blows everything up and when he figures out how to win with his hands, he can be pretty special.

Im Eberflus defense, Stewart can play both outside and inside. He gives alot of package possibilities with the different personel you can put on the field with him. He can be a B gap rusher inside. Outside he can play anywhere from a 5 to 9 with his athleticism
